shell

使用ubuntu一段时间了,每次开机都要自己去进入目录启动php和nginx,是有点让人不愉快。

开始先写了个shell,然后保存他 及修改权限,以后就只需要开机执行这个shell就可以实现启动了,还有一种更好的方法,直接把nginx和php-fpm的启动shell目录及文件名添加进入开机启动的脚本里面就可以了,在Ubuntu里面 本地开机文件位置在/etc/rc.local/ ,debian在 /etc/init.d/rc.local,Fedora /etc/rc.d/rc.local .稍微总结以下目前学的部分shell知识,shell 里面定义变量直接用=号,且赋值的时候不能有空格,被赋值的变量前面不加$符号,在使用的时候则需要加上,如果需要把shell命令的输出赋值给变量 则应该使用反引号,使用echo 可以显示消息 这点php和shell 神似,在一行里面使用多个命令需要用分号进行分割,输出重定向使用>符号,输入重定向使用符号<,是将文件的内容重定向到命令。结构化命令,选择和循环。也可以使用函数,甚至图形化,及正则表达式等等,功能十分强大!

2016-03-23 23-08-00屏幕截图.png

nickname
content